§ 62D.403 — Issuance of order to join governmental entity or person as party to proceeding to enforce legal obligation to child

Nevada·Title 5 JUVENILE JUSTICE·Ch. 62D Procedure· MISCELLANEOUS PROVISIONS
In each proceeding conducted pursuant to the provisions of this title, the juvenile court may issue an order to join any governmental entity or other person as a party to enforce a legal obligation of the entity or person to the child who is the subject of the proceeding if, before issuing the order, the court provides notice and an opportunity to be heard to the governmental entity or person.
